Hello Fresh, parent company of Factor, donates meals, van to Northern Illinois Food Bank, Loaves and Fishes

AURORA, Ill. (WLS) — There is new hope for local families facing food insecurity.

A donation Wednesday will meet a crucial need for people in the Aurora area.

An assembly line of volunteers passed boxes of meals to load them onto a van.

Not only did the Northern Illinois Food Bank get balanced nutritious meals, but also a van to transport them. All were donated by Factor.

“The vans provided are refrigerated, enabling them to serve a wider range of individuals facing food insecurity in the region,” stated Hello Fresh COO, Dan Seidel.

Hello Fresh, the parent organization of Factor, is contributing five refrigerated vans to Chicago-area food pantries, including Loaves and Fishes, which has observed a significant surge in demand for their services.

“In a span of less than four years, we have tripled our reach. We currently serve 2,800 individuals and 10,000 families each week,” mentioned Melissa Luken, from Loaves and Fishes.

Experts say there are several factors, including inflation, contributing to the increase in food insecurity. But officials are seeing it all over northern Illinois, including in Aurora. The need is greater than ever.

“It’s a lot of people working two, three jobs that require that little bit of extra help,” Deputy Mayor Casildo “Casey” Cuevas said.

“Federal funding has been lost; grants have been lost. Income has been lost to our families; so, it’s very complex problem,” Aurora Deputy Chief of Staff Nicholas Richard-Thompson said.

Seidel lined up alongside other volunteers to fill up the refrigerated van with boxes of donated meals: part of the solution. One was going to the Northern Illinois Food Bank, which is grateful.

“The fact they’re giving it to us to assist in our mission is fantastic,” said Chuck Falco, with Northern Illinois Food bank.

A lot of the clients that Loves and Fishes serves are elderly and homebound and unable to get to the pantry to pick up food.

The van will allow them to deliver it to right where they are.
